Things to consider
Higher = more presentNo sexual content is present in the narrative.
The story does not contain any violence.
The dialogue is free of profanity.
No blasphemous language or themes are included.
Substance use is not depicted in the story.
The book does not feature themes of suicide or self-harm.
The story is not scary.
Occult or witchcraft themes are absent.
No LGBTQ+ themes are present in the story.
The story focuses on everyday life and relationships.
No specific portrayal of Christians is present.
Virtues to celebrate
Higher = stronger presenceNikki and Deja show resilience in their daily lives.
Faith is not a theme explored in this book.
The strong bond of friendship between Nikki and Deja is central.
Themes of grace and repentance are not present.
